Finance Review Summary — Lease Renegotiation, Ostwick Premises

Sales leads: renegotiation of the Ostwick showroom lease concluded last week. New terms cut annual occupancy costs 11% in exchange for a five-year commitment. Break clause retained at year three. The savings fund the planned demo-floor refresh; no impact on your territory budgets this quarter. Keep terms confidential until the landlord's announcement. The wider business rationale, for director-level eyes, is noted below.

board note of bawep-tajef: Queniusek Systems plans to raise the Quenvan list price by 53.1 percent in March. The pricing group signed off on a budget of $176.4 million for Project Drueth. The renewal with Casionix Partners closes at $142.5 million a year, 8.3 percent below the last contract. Project Fraax slips by six weeks because of the tooling delay.

**Vendor note: Inkmill markdown pipeline**

Rendering for Parchway docs is outsourced to Inkmill under an annual contract, renewing each March. They handle sanitization and PDF export; we own the upload queue. SLA: 4-hour response on rendering failures. Escalate only after two failed retries. Their support desk is reachable at the address below.

billing contact of hahaf-baguf = zorael.tammir.jorius@sivrelhq.internal

## Approvals: Sandboxing User-Supplied Formulas

Welcome to the Tidepool platform team. Any change touching the formula sandbox — the interpreter in Reefgate, its allowlisted functions, or resource limits — requires explicit approval before merge. This is non-negotiable: user formulas run against shared tenant data, and a sandbox escape would be severe. Open a review tagged `sandbox-change`, include a threat note describing what new capability (if any) is exposed, and wait for sign-off. The approver for all sandbox changes is listed below.

named custodian: Belius Casath Ulaix Sorius